### Note for Plugin Authors: Gateway Rate Limits

Heads up — the Bramblegate internal API gateway now enforces a per-plugin quota of 120 requests per minute, with burst allowance of 200. Exceeding it gets you a 429 and a cooldown, not a ban. If your plugin genuinely needs more headroom, ask nicely and include traffic estimates; requests go to the gateway crew at the address below.

pager mailbox: druwyn@norvaio.corp

## Limits & Quotas — Crashline Report Pipeline

This page documents quotas for the Crashline mobile crash-report pipeline, relevant to security review. Reports are size-capped at ingest, stripped of oversized attachments, and rate-limited per device to blunt flooding attacks. Symbolication workers enforce a per-report CPU budget, and retention is bounded so stack traces age out automatically. All enforcement points read from a single constants module, reproduced here.

tuning table, yajog-yahof:
BUDGETS = {
    "lamvan": 303,
    "wenox": 460,
    "fenvan": 525,
}

**Runbook: Webhook retry semantics**

Plugins receiving deliveries from the Hollowpost dispatcher should treat any non-2xx response as retryable. We retry five times with exponential backoff starting at thirty seconds, then park the event for manual replay. Ensure your endpoint is idempotent, since duplicates are possible. Retry behavior described here applies starting from the dispatcher build noted below.

session token of fawep-tajep = htk14_4221f8eaf43a2f

Handover: request tracing

Hey — passing the tracing work on Glimmerhut's microservices over to you. Span propagation works through the gateway and order service; the inventory hop still drops trace IDs on async calls (see my notes in the repo). Sampling is at 10%, don't bump it without checking storage costs. For anything unclear, the person now on the hook is listed below.

account owner for bawip-tahag: Raleth Quenok

Handover — Veldkamp Trial Plot Seeds

Marta, the twelve seed sample tins for the Veldkamp north trial plot are on rack C, sealed and logged. Keep them below 18°C and do not stack anything on top; the germination team at Brindlehoff flagged moisture risk. A courier from Larkspoor Logistics collects them tomorrow before noon. The hand-over instruction for the courier is as follows:

handover note for yagef-bagep: the drudor pelius courier leaves the kasdor zorvan norir ledger at gate 8016 under passcode 755406